This incredibly flavorful and stunning dish is a perfect side at Thanksgiving, but it’s also hearty enough to satisfy as a vegetarian entree. Layers of sweet potatoes, thyme-infused cream and two kinds of cheese make it pretty irresistible. We went one step further and added caramelized shallots for a show-stopper of a recipe.
If you don’t have a food processor, you can use a mandoline or a very sharp knife.
The shallots can be caramelized up to 2 days in advance and stored in the refrigerator.
If you want to make this sweet potato gratin with gruyere and caramelized shallots recipe ahead of time, bake for the first 30 minutes, cool completely and store in the refrigerator. Then cook the second 30 minutes the day you are serving.
